The Rolex GMT-Master Ref. 16750, often affectionately referred to as the "Pepsi" due to its iconic red and blue bezel, holds a special place in the hearts of watch enthusiasts. This particular reference represents a significant evolution in the GMT-Master line, bridging the gap between earlier models and the more modern iterations. Its enduring appeal stems from a potent combination of robust functionality, timeless design, and a rich history that continues to fascinate collectors worldwide. Rolex GMT-Master 16750 Price: A Market in Flux
The price of a Rolex GMT-Master Ref. 16750 is a complex issue, influenced by numerous factors including condition, provenance, box and papers, and the current market climate. While a cash wire price of $14,495 is cited as an example, this should be considered a single data point. The actual price can fluctuate significantly. Several key aspects determine the final cost:
* Condition: The overall condition of the watch is paramount. A pristine example with minimal signs of wear will command a significantly higher price than one showing considerable age and use. Scratches, dings, and imperfections all affect the value. The condition of the bezel insert, often prone to fading, is particularly crucial.
* Provenance and Box & Papers: The presence of original box and papers significantly boosts the value. A complete set dramatically increases desirability and authenticity verification, thus impacting the price. Knowing the watch's history, if documented, can also add to its allure and price.
* Market Demand: Like all luxury goods, the market for vintage Rolexes, and the 16750 in particular, is subject to fluctuations in demand. Popularity, trends, and overall economic conditions can influence pricing.
* Dial Variations: Slight variations in dials, such as the presence of a "spider" dial (discussed later), can affect the price. Certain dial configurations are more sought after by collectors, commanding premium prices.
Therefore, while the $14,495 price point serves as a benchmark, it's essential to consult reputable dealers and auction houses for the most up-to-date and accurate pricing information. Expect significant variations based on the factors mentioned above.
Rolex 16750 GMT for Sale: Finding Your Grail
Finding a Rolex GMT-Master Ref. 16750 for sale requires diligence and careful research. Several avenues exist for potential buyers:
* Reputable Dealers: Working with established and reputable dealers specializing in vintage Rolex watches is crucial. These dealers provide authentication services and offer warranties, mitigating the risks associated with purchasing a vintage watch.
* Online Marketplaces: Online marketplaces like eBay and Chrono24 offer a vast selection of vintage watches. However, buyers must exercise extreme caution, carefully verifying the authenticity of the watch before purchasing. Using escrow services can help protect buyers from fraudulent transactions.
* Auction Houses: Auction houses frequently feature vintage Rolex watches, including the 16750. This can be an excellent avenue for securing a rare or highly sought-after example, though prices can be competitive.
Remember to thoroughly inspect any watch before purchase, ideally with a qualified watchmaker, to ensure its authenticity and condition.
